Nicole Büchner is a scholar working on Molecular Biology, Physiology and Cellular and Molecular Neuroscience. According to data from OpenAlex, Nicole Büchner has authored 9 papers receiving a total of 821 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 6 papers in Molecular Biology, 5 papers in Physiology and 1 paper in Cellular and Molecular Neuroscience. Recurrent topics in Nicole Büchner's work include Telomeres, Telomerase, and Senescence (4 papers), Mitochondrial Function and Pathology (2 papers) and Redox biology and oxidative stress (2 papers). Nicole Büchner is often cited by papers focused on Telomeres, Telomerase, and Senescence (4 papers), Mitochondrial Function and Pathology (2 papers) and Redox biology and oxidative stress (2 papers). Nicole Büchner collaborates with scholars based in Germany, United Kingdom and Singapore. Nicole Büchner's co-authors include Judith Haendeler, Joachim Altschmied, Sascha Jakob, Ioakim Spyridopoulos, Stefanie Dimmeler, Ulrich Brandt, Christine Goy, Stefan Dröse, Andreas M. Zeiher and Christian Werner and has published in prestigious journals such as Journal of Biological Chemistry, Circulation and Arteriosclerosis Thrombosis and Vascular Biology.
